Shiwan ceramic sculpture
2016-11-21
Shiwan is a town located in the southwest of the city of Foshan, with a long history of ceramic sculpture passed down through several generations of craftsmen. Its 5000-year-long ceramic making history has accumulated a rich and abundant ceramic culture, and won Shiwan the high prestige of the “Ceramics Capital of Southern China”.

Guangdong Lion Dance
2016-09-21
The Guangdong Lion Dance, a national intangible cultural heritage popular in Foshan City, Suixi County and Guangzhou City, is a typical Southern Lion Dance.
The Ballads of Meizhou
2016-10-12
As Hakka culture, a branch of the Han ethnic group, spread throughout southern China during the Jin Dynasty (AD 265 – 420), along with it traveled the poetry and ballads of nomadic life and love.
Zhongshan 'saltwater' song
2016-09-29
For people from Zhongshan, Guangdong province, the sound of Xianshui is unforgettable. Literally meaning "saltwater", Xianshui is a traditional style of folk music found along the Pearl River, especially in the Tanzhou region.
Foshan New Year wood engravings
2016-09-29
In Foshan, New Year paintings have developed differently. Rather than print the flamboyant designs onto paper, locals there prefer to meticulously carve them onto blocks of wood.
